RIPON, Wis. - Ripon's baseball team lost both games of a doubleheader against Beloit College Sunday afternoon in what was the Red Hawks' 2017 season finale. Beloit won the first game 10-4, before also taking the nightcap by a 9-5 margin.
The day got started with a wild first inning that saw a combined seven runs, six hits, and three errors. Beloit (17-17-1, 11-5-1 MWC) scored three runs in the top of the first, but Ripon answered with four runs in the bottom of that frame.
Josh Oswald drove in one of those runs via a sac fly, and
Riley Erickson gave the Red Hawks the lead with a two-run double to left center.
Ripon (9-26, 7-10 MWC) would play with that lead until the fourth inning when Beloit tied the score at four on an RBI groundout. The Buccaneers would then take the lead in the fifth, which featured six runs on four hits, including a pair of bases loaded walks and a two-run double.
Ripon finished the game with nine hits, with three apiece coming from
Isiah Ramos and
Randy Finger.
Ben Folger pitched 4.2 scoreless innings of relief, allowing just one hit and striking out two, but that was not enough.
The day's second game saw Ripon grab the initial lead when Erickson scored on a groundout in the bottom of the second. That lead lasted until the top of the fourth when Beloit scored their first two runs of the game.
Ripon took the lead again in the sixth, scoring three runs on three hits.
Robbie Schuettpelz singled in the tying run, while Ramos gave the Red Hawks the lead by driving in a run on a sacrifice bunt, before
Nick Taranto singled home another run.
One inning later, Beloit tied the score with a pair of runs, and they would take the lead with two more runs in the top of the eighth. Ripon added a run in the bottom of that inning on another RBI single by Taranto to cut the lead to 6-5, but a three-run ninth by Beloit would put the game on ice and secure the sweep for the Buccaneers.
Ripon finished with 13 hits, with three coming from both Schuettpelz and
Bennett Groves. Taranto, Erickson, and
David La Tour each added two base knocks.
